What are UPVC Windows and Doors?

UPVC doors and windows are made from a robust and long lasting material called unplasticized polyvinyl chloride. Unlike standard products like wood or aluminum, UPVC is understood for its resistance to weathering, rust, and chemical damage. These features make UPVC a perfect option for contemporary homes, combining both performance and aesthetic appeal.

Benefits of UPVC Windows and Doors

UPVC windows and doors offer a plethora of benefits, making them a preferred choice among homeowners and contractors. Some of these advantages include:

  1. Energy Efficiency:

    • UPVC doors and windows have outstanding thermal insulation homes, avoiding heat loss throughout winter season and heat entry in summer. This can substantially decrease energy bills.
  2. Improved Security:

    • Many UPVC profiles come with multi-point locking systems and enhanced structures that offer increased security versus burglaries.
  3. Low Maintenance:

    • Unlike wood, which needs routine painting and treatment, UPVC does not require frequent upkeep. Cleaning up is as simple as wiping with a wet cloth.
  4. Aesthetic Appeal:

    • UPVC doors and windows can be tailored to match any architectural style and come in numerous colors and surfaces, including wood-grain results, supplying the wanted visual without the typical downsides of lumber.
  5. Sound Reduction:

    • The airtight seal of UPVC frames assists to shut out external sound, including an element of tranquility to the living environment.
  6. Cost-efficient:

    • Although the preliminary investment may be slightly greater than conventional doors and windows, the long-lasting savings on maintenance and energy expenses make UPVC an economical option.

Installation of UPVC Windows and Doors

The setup process of UPVC windows and doors is crucial for guaranteeing their efficiency and longevity. Here's an introduction of the steps included:

Step-by-Step Installation Process

  1. Measurement:

    • Accurate measurements of doors and window openings are important to ensuring an ideal fit.
  2. Preparation:

    • Remove any existing frames and prepare the openings by cleaning and leveling the surfaces.
  3. Dry Fit:

    • Place the UPVC frames into the openings without attaching them to look for fit and guarantee that they are level.
  4. Securing the Frame:

    • Once effectively fitted, the frames are protected using screws or other fasteners, guaranteeing they are sealed firmly.
  5. Sealing:

    • Apply proper sealants to avoid air and water seepage, further enhancing the energy efficiency of the installation.
  6. Finishing Touches:

    • Install trims or ending up pieces to offer the setup a polished appearance.

Maintenance of UPVC Windows and Doors

Though UPVC needs minimal maintenance, appropriate care can guarantee longevity and ideal performance. Here are some maintenance ideas:

Maintenance Tips for UPVC Windows and Doors

  • Routine Cleaning: Use moderate cleaning agents with water to clean the frames and glass.
  • Inspect Seals and Hinges: Regularly check weather seals and hinges and change them if used or harmed.
  • Lubrication: Apply a silicon-based lubricant to moving parts like locks and hinges to make sure smooth operation.
  • Examine for Damage: Periodically check for any indications of damage or wear and address issues quickly.

FAQs About UPVC Windows and Doors

Q1: How long do UPVC windows and doors last?

A1: UPVC windows and doors can last as much as 25 years or longer, depending upon the quality of the products and maintenance.

Q2: Are UPVC windows energy effective?

A2: Yes, UPVC doors and windows offer excellent insulation, helping to reduce energy costs and maintain indoor convenience.

Q3: Can UPVC windows and doors be painted?

A3: While painting UPVC is possible, it is usually not advised as it can void service warranties. UPVC is offered in numerous surfaces that do not require painting.

Q4: Are UPVC windows secure?

A4: Yes, UPVC windows and doors come with multi-point locking systems and can be strengthened for included security.

Q5: How do UPVC windows compare to wood windows?

A5: UPVC windows are normally more long lasting, need less maintenance, and offer better insulation compared to wooden windows, which are more susceptible to rot and need routine maintenance.
